Sometimes what managers achieve are beyond the simple X number of trophies / promotions and Y win % I believe we'd agree that Pearson is doing a decent job at City despite a very poor win percentage and looking at the table right now, not much tangible improvement What Pearson has done is bring through plenty of youth, given us a team we can be proud of watching (more often than not, despite some poor performances) and massively reduced our wage bill whilst keeping us somewhat competitive in this league. Southgate has turned a very devisive England camp into one of unity, one that the players look forward to going to. He's given us a team to be proud of, he's avoided any off-pitch controversy and where his players have been involved in trouble I feel he's handled it very well. A World Cup semi final is more than I'd seen in my lifetime prior, a Euro final even more so. Given the previous years saw us either not qualify, get thumped by Germany, crash out of the group stages or be embarrased by Iceland. He's been there and seen failure at the highest level, he's used that to help manage his players and mentor them. There was some serious apathy about the England side after Euro 2016, Southgate has turned that around 6 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
